If it follows the pattern of both of our 2011s ( his and hers), it will gradually get more frequent. The part that fails is plastic and wears out... it is just a small plastic disk type thing with a D cut in it that a post goes through... the D becomes more O like and then the post can't move it anymore causing the failure..
